How February compares in Amsterdam

February ranks 12th of 12 months for running in Amsterdam, with a typical daytime Run Score of 77 (Good). It's the toughest month of the year here — temperatures around 44°F (7°C) with comfortable dew points near 39°F. Precipitation falls in roughly 26% of hours this month. Running in Amsterdam in February: FAQ

Is it good to run in Amsterdam in February?

Generally yes, with sensible timing. The typical daytime Run Score is 77 (Good), with temperatures around 44°F (7°C) and comfortable dew points. The best window is usually 6 AM–11 PM.

How hot is it for running in Amsterdam in February?

Typical temperatures average 44°F (7°C) (Cool) with dew points near 39°F. Dew point — not the thermometer — usually decides how hard the run feels.

Why does dew point matter more than temperature?

Your body cools by evaporating sweat. When the dew point climbs above roughly 60°F, the air is too saturated for sweat to evaporate efficiently, so heat builds up even if the thermometer looks reasonable. That's why a 70°F muggy morning can feel harder than a dry 80°F afternoon.
